热门标签 | HotTags
当前位置:  开发笔记 > 开发工具 > 正文

动态合并工作表,放到哪里也能刷新

小伙伴们好啊,昨天老祝和大家分享了一个动态合并多个工作表的技巧动态合并多个工作表,数据再多也不怕。有小伙伴提出一个非常现实的问题:在合并完成后,一旦将文件移动到其他位置,合并的数据

小伙伴们好啊,昨天老祝和大家分享了一个动态合并多个工作表的技巧动态合并多个工作表,数据再多也不怕。

有小伙伴提出一个非常现实的问题:在合并完成后,一旦将文件移动到其他位置,合并的数据就无法刷新了图片

图片


接下来,咱们以下图所示的数据为例,说说如何在移动文件时,咱们的查询仍然能自动刷新结果。

图片

三个工作表中是某品牌的商品,在不同区域的销售记录。


步骤1:

新建两个工作表,分别重命名为“汇总表”和“路径表”,在“路径表”中输入公式,得到当前工作簿的完整路径,然后保存一下。

=CELL("filename")

图片


单击A2单元格,然后将数据加载到数据查询编辑器里。

图片


由于公式生成的路径中,还包含有工作表名称以及一对中括号,接下来咱们使用拆分列和替换的方法,提取出能使用的路径。

图片


步骤2:

依次单击【主页】→【新建源】→【文件】→【Excel】,根据提示导入数据。

图片


步骤3

在编辑栏中,将公式中表示路径的文本部分清除掉,改成:

表1{0}[路径.1]

其中的“表1”,就是刚刚导入的路径连接,{0} 表示第一行,“[路径.1]”就是咱们前面拆分列之后得到的新列名。

再将null改成 true,这样修改后,系统就可以自动识别出字段名称,并自动进行归类了。

图片

但是此时会出现一个警告提示,咱们还要来个小手术:

依次单击【文件】→【选项和设置】→ 【查询选项】→设置全局隐私级别为“始终忽略隐私级别设置”。

然后点击一下刷新预览按钮,警告对话框就没有了。

图片


步骤4    

在数据查询编辑器中,使用筛选功能把多余的名称都排除掉,单击【Kind】字段的筛选按钮,在筛选菜单中选择“Sheet”的类型。

除此之外,还需要将在【Name】字段中,将“汇总表”和“路径表”也筛选掉,否则合并后会增加很多重复的记录。

图片


步骤5:

按住Ctrl键不放,依次单击【Name】和【Date】字段的标题来选中这两列,单击鼠标右键→【删除其他列】。

接下来单击【Date】字段的展开按钮,将数据展开。

图片


步骤6:

单击日期字段的标题,将格式设置为“日期”,然后依次单击【关闭并上载】→【关闭并上载至】,在弹出的【导入数据】对话框中,选择【仅创建连接】。

图片


步骤7 

切换到“汇总表”工作表中,在右侧的【查询&连接】窗格中,右键单击“动态合并多工作表中的数据”这个连接,选择“加载到”命令,将数据加载到工作表中。

图片


操作完成后,将这个工作簿移动到任意位置,哪怕是修改文件名,再刷新也没有问题了。

今天的练习文件在此,你也试试吧。

https://pan.baidu.com/s/1ar8g9M8IE1j6SL0eAv9Zcw 提取码: ckr8 




推荐阅读
  • 三星W799在2011年的表现堪称经典,以其独特的双屏设计和强大的功能引领了双模手机的潮流。本文详细介绍其配置、功能及锁屏设置。 ... [详细]
  • 如何配置Unturned服务器及其消息设置
    本文详细介绍了Unturned服务器的配置方法和消息设置技巧,帮助用户了解并优化服务器管理。同时,提供了关于云服务资源操作记录、远程登录设置以及文件传输的相关补充信息。 ... [详细]
  • 本文介绍如何通过注册表编辑器自定义和优化Windows文件右键菜单,包括删除不需要的菜单项、添加绿色版或非安装版软件以及将特定应用程序(如Sublime Text)添加到右键菜单中。 ... [详细]
  • 深入理解Shell脚本编程
    本文详细介绍了Shell脚本编程的基础概念、语法结构及其在操作系统中的应用。通过具体的示例代码,帮助读者掌握如何编写和执行Shell脚本。 ... [详细]
  • Unity编辑器插件:NGUI资源引用检测工具
    本文介绍了一款基于NGUI的资源引用检测工具,该工具能够帮助开发者快速查找和管理项目中的资源引用。其功能涵盖Atlas/Sprite、字库、UITexture及组件的引用检测,并提供了替换和修复功能。文末提供源码下载链接。 ... [详细]
  • 本文介绍了ArcXML配置文件的分类及其在不同服务中的应用,详细解释了地图配置文件的结构和功能,包括其在Image Service、Feature Service以及ArcMap Server中的使用方法。 ... [详细]
  • 如何使用PyCharm及常用配置详解
    对于一枚pycharm工具的使用新手,正确了解这门工具的配置及其使用,在使用过程中遇到的很多问题也可以迎刃而解,文中有非常详细的介绍, ... [详细]
  • Python处理Word文档的高效技巧
    本文详细介绍了如何使用Python处理Word文档,涵盖从基础操作到高级功能的各种技巧。我们将探讨如何生成文档、定义样式、提取表格数据以及处理超链接和图片等内容。 ... [详细]
  • 如何在CAD查看器中同时打开并对比两张DWG图纸
    本文将详细介绍如何使用专业的CAD查看软件,如迅捷CAD看图,来同时打开和对比两张DWG格式的CAD图纸。无论是在设计审核还是项目管理中,掌握这一技能都能显著提高工作效率。 ... [详细]
  • Ulysses Mac v29:革新文本编辑与写作体验
    探索Ulysses Mac v29,这款先进的纯文本编辑器为Mac用户带来了全新的写作和编辑环境。它不仅具备简洁直观的界面,还融合了Markdown等标记语言的最佳特性,支持多种格式导出,并提供强大的组织和同步功能。 ... [详细]
  • 本文详细介绍了Vim编辑器的三种主要模式及其常用命令,帮助用户更好地掌握这一强大的文本编辑工具。 ... [详细]
  • 解决Windows 10开机频繁自检问题的实用方法
    许多用户在使用Windows 10系统时,经常会遇到开机时自动进行磁盘检查的情况。这不仅影响了开机速度,还可能带来不必要的麻烦。本文将详细介绍如何通过简单的注册表修改来避免每次开机时的磁盘自检,提升系统启动效率。 ... [详细]
  • 本文详细介绍了流编辑器sed中的G、H、g、h命令,探讨了它们的工作原理及应用场景。通过实例解析和图解分析,帮助读者掌握这些高级命令的使用方法。 ... [详细]
  • HTML基础入门指南
    本文将深入浅出地介绍HTML的基础知识,包括其定义、开发工具、制定机构、特性、基本标签及更多实用内容。 ... [详细]
  • 本文介绍了解决Oracle 10G数据库中ORA-12541 TNS: no listener错误的详细步骤。该错误通常发生在监听器服务未正确启动或配置不当的情况下,文章将指导您通过检查服务状态、配置注册表和启动监听器来解决问题。 ... [详细]
author-avatar
书友48058773
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有